Released in 2018, Container is a drama film directed by Kim Se-in, running about 26 minutes.
What it’s about. A working-class residential village suffers from a flood. Without proper relief measures in place, the flood victims have no choice but to stay inside a cramped, filthy container together temporarily. A young girl named Gyeongju who is staying there with her mother notices Eunae who is by herself. In the midst of the poverty, redevelopment scheme and the cold selfishness of the grown-ups within the community, Gyeongju’s gaze upon Eunae is completely free from any prejudice. The film is a powerful portrayal of the barren landscape of the village soon to be demolished and a young girl who cannot find peace of mind. [JUNG Jiyoun]
Who’s in it. Container stars Park Hye-jin as Gyeong-ju, Jang Hae-geum as Eun-ae and Park Hui-eun as Gyeong-ju's Mother.
